Hi! Happy to be announcing that Task Coach is now updated to Python3 and development is finally active again, thanks to new volunteers. The project has now moved to https://github.com/taskcoach/taskcoach
I'm using it myself, and things are working better than ever. Packages are available for some common Linux systems and for Windows (note that it isn't recognized by Windows Smartscreen but can be installed by accepting the warning anyway)
We'd love to have you test the updated program, and post any issues that arise there at GitHub. Please report this there if you can still reproduce the problem with the new release.
We won't be continuing with SourceForge, just clearing out old issues and letting people know about the move
